Prompt Based Creation
Prompt based creation refers to the use of AI agents and tools that generate content, automate tasks, and increase productivity through natural language instructions. Rather than manually performing repetitive workflows, users input descriptive prompts that guide AI systems to produce desired outputs. This approach leverages large language models and specialized AI tools to handle everything from content generation to task automation.
Core Mechanism
The fundamental workflow involves a user providing a text-based instruction or prompt that describes what they want to accomplish. An AI system interprets this instruction and executes the corresponding task or generates the requested output. The quality and specificity of the prompt directly influence the quality of the results, making clear communication between user and system essential.
Applications and Scope
Prompt based creation is applied across diverse domains including writing, design, coding, data analysis, and business automation. Users can generate articles, create visual designs, write and debug code, summarize documents, and automate administrative workflows. The flexibility of natural language makes this approach accessible to users without specialized technical training, democratizing access to automated tools and processes.
Practical Impact
By reducing the time spent on repetitive tasks, prompt based creation allows individuals and organizations to focus on higher-level strategic work. The technology continues to evolve as underlying AI models improve, enabling more complex and nuanced task execution through increasingly sophisticated prompt engineering techniques.
